The functioning of Comoros' electricity network has improved significantly in recent years, thanks to an African Development Bank-supported project. . Comoros, an island nation in Southeastern Africa, faces ongoing challenges in providing reliable electricity, particularly in rural areas. According to the World Bank, while nearly 83% of rural residents had access to electricity as of 2022, many communities, which vary by island, still lack the. . UNDP Comoros and the government identified Ouzini as a priority community to benefit from a solar energy powered minigrid funded by the Africa Minigrids program. Approved in 2013, the project aims to respond to a twofold. . The Union of the Comoros is an archipelago located off Mozambique and Madagascar in the Indian Ocean. Comoros has a population of 758,316, including 379,367 in Grande Comoros, 327,367 in Anjouan and 51,567 in Mohéli (RGPH1 2017 estimates).

Saudi Electricity Company (SEC) has secured two massive battery energy storage systems totaling 4. 9 GWh at a cost of just USD 73-75 per kilowatt-hour (kWh) installed, marking a potential turning point for energy storage economics outside China.
